Obituary of Gary Robert Wolf

 

Gary Robert Wolf passed away on June 20, 2020, after a six-year battle with kidney cancer.

Born in West Point, NY on April 2, 1953, Gary was 67 years old. He is survived by the women he loved the most: his daughter, Madeleine, his wife, Jennifer, former spouse, Cissy, and step-daughter, Emily.

A proud veteran of the US Navy, Gary was lead counsel for 19 submarines at Pearl Harbor while serving as a Navy Jag Officer and general counsel for an agency of the Defense Department. He practiced law for 39 years, building his own successful practice as a passionate criminal defense attorney. A fierce advocate for justice and equality before the law, he was dedicated to serving his clients and the wider community. This dedication earned him numerous accolades and the respect of those he worked with.

Gary will be remembered for his integrity, wit, generosity, and his impressive Hawaiian tattoos.

A public memorial service will be held on a future date. In lieu of flowers, those wishing to offer remembrance should please donate to their local no-kill animal shelter.
